Ayurveda
is
considered by many scholars to be the oldest healing
science. It is the "The Science of Life". Ayurvedic
knowledge originated in India more than 5,000 years ago.
It stems from the ancient Vedic culture and was taught for
many thousands of years in an oral tradition from
accomplished masters to their disciples. Some of this
knowledge was set to print a few thousand years ago, but
much of it is lost. The principles of many natural healing
systems now familiar in the West have their roots in
Ayurveda. Ayurveda was the first medicinal science that
started treating both body and soul of the ill people. It
advises ways to achieve complete happiness by recommending
the ideal way of living.

Etymologically, the word
Ayurveda is made up of two basic terms - Ayu and Veda. Ayu
means life and Veda means knowledge or science. So the
literal meaning of the word Ayurveda is the
science of life.
Ayurveda stresses the prevention of disease and advocates
the use of healing herbs. Knowledge of this science helps
to achieve and maintain the balanced health through a
suitable diet, lifestyle and the use of body, mind and
consciousness
according to the individual constitution (prakriti). Life
according to Ayurveda is a combination of senses, mind,
body and soul. From this definition is clear that Ayurveda
is not limited to body or physical symptoms. It gives a
comprehensive knowledge about spiritual, mental and
social health laying the path to a complete way of fit and
healthy life.
Ayurveda is an ancient
Indian medical science. It is a natural health care
system, so called the "mother of healing". It teaches how
to achieve optimal physical, mental, and emotional health
by living in harmony with nature. It is a complete science
laying guidelines not only for the ill but for the healthy
too. Ayurveda is thus both preventive and curative
medicinal science. It deals with a wide variety of fields
like common medicine, gynecology, pediatrics, surgery,
anatomy, E.N.T., dentistry, herbal drugs, ayurvedic
dieting and nutrition and rejuvenation medicine. Unlike
modern western medicine which focuses on treating the
symptoms of an illness, Ayurveda concentrates on the
source of the disease using natural treatments to
eliminate the root cause and promote the patient's
immunity.
